Abstract

The present invention provides a liquid detergent composition for commercial dishwashers that exhibits low metal corrosiveness, good cleaning performance, and excellent re-soiling prevention and scale buildup prevention, even in water-saving automatic dishwashers where accumulation of cleaning solution is significant. [Solution] (A) One or more selected from L-glutamic acid diacetic acid, methylglycine diacetic acid, and their alkali metal salts, in an amount of 3% to 20% by mass, (B) an aminoethanol compound, (C) Sodium hydroxide in an amount of 7% by mass or less, (D) Potassium hydroxide in an amount of 7% by mass or less, (E) One or more polymer compounds selected from polyacrylic acid having acrylic acid as a monomer unit, polyacrylic acid copolymers which are copolymers of acrylic acid as a monomer unit and monomer units having a carboxyl group copolymerizable with acrylic acid, and alkali metal salts thereof, in an amount of 0.2% by mass or more and 5% by mass or less, and the remainder being water. (F) Contains virtually no carbonates and silicates, or contains less than 1% by mass of carbonates and silicates when converted to sodium salts. A liquid detergent composition for automatic dishwashers is used, which has a pH of 12 or higher at 25°C and a pH of 10 or higher for a 0.1% by mass aqueous solution.
